[19], On September 21, 2008, Probst won the first Primetime Emmy Award for Outstanding Host for a Reality or Reality-Competition Program. He is best known as the Emmy Award-winning host of the U.S. version of the reality television show Survivor since 2000. In high school, he started making short films and later joined his father at Boeing as a production assistant, producing (and later hosting) marketing and training videos. From September 10, 2012, Probst hosted The Jeff Probst Show, a syndicated daytime talk show produced by CBS Television Distribution from September 2012 to May 2013.
